Nutritional Recommendations for Sport Team Athletes

Image

Abstract

In present days, consistent scientific evidence is confirming that nutritional intake has an essential role in optimizing training and competition performance in athletes. When nutritional practices are adequate, athletes can exploit their maximum talent performance, while promoting a suitable recovery process with a lower risk of disease and sport injuries. Therefore, in order to address these issues, it is important to clearly define all the nutritional parameters which optimize the athletes feeding practices: energy intake, macro and micronutrients consumption and hydration practices. To begin, it will be necessary to estimate the individuals total daily energy requirement, its mean, the calories the athlete will expend and if any changes in body composition are required. It will also be important to obtain a negative or positive energetic balance for fat loss or muscle mass gain respectively, through a progressive process carried out alongside a sports nutritionist. In any case, the first step will be to estimate the resting metabolic rate (RMR) value of the athlete by using the Cunningham equation, which is the best recommended option for athletes, or the Harris-Benedict equation as a second option, when lean mass data is not known. Progressively, it will be necessary to add the calories spent in training and physical activities (thermic effect of activities) while taking into account the thermic effect of food.
